    Healing Herbs
    Ring worm was cured with an 'herb' called 'House Leak' which grows on houses. It should be boiled on milk, then bruised, and put on the spot where the ring worm is.
    Roast an Ivy leaf and put it on the spot where the thorn is and it is supposed to draw it out.
    Dandelion boiled on milk is a cure for a sore throat.
    Chicken Weed is a cure for a cut or swelling.
    A Dockin is a cure for a burn from a neetle.
    Feeding Herbs
    Dandelion is given to pigs when boiled with meal.
    Nettles is given to turkeys when boiled.
